Exploring Synthetic Cannabinoids: A Look at their Science and Impact

Synthetic cannabinoids, sometimes called "spice" or "synthetic marijuana," are man-made chemicals designed to mimic the effects of THC, the psychoactive component in cannabis. These substances are often sprayed onto leaves, which is then sold as a herbal incense or smoking mixture. Despite appearing to be legal, synthetic cannabinoids pose serious health risks.

The molecular compositions of these compounds are constantly evolving, often making it difficult for regulators to keep up. This rapid evolution means that the influence of synthetic cannabinoids can be highly fluctuating. Users may experience a range of side effects, including anxiety, paranoia, hallucinations, seizures, and even death.

Synthetic Cannabinoids: Emerging Threats and Public Safety

The rapid proliferation of synthetic cannabinoids presents a multifaceted challenge for public health officials and policymakers. These substances, often sold under trademarks that mimic legitimate cannabis products, exploit legal regulatory gaps. Manufacturers can regularly modify their formulas to stay ahead of legal prohibitions, making it challenging for regulators to keep pace. This constant evolution poses a serious threat to public health, as the consequences of these substances can be unpredictable and {potentiallyharmful. A lack of standardized testing and regulation also increases the risk of adulteration with harmful compounds.
